Review Request 117729: Text-UI breaks "Per window" keyboard layout switching
Commit Hook
null at kde.org
Wed Apr 23 20:34:18 UTC 2014
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/117729/#review56321
-----------------------------------------------------------
This review has been submitted with commit 68ffd6e4ec2525287a3a00ddbabefcac0be3ce9f by David Edmundson on behalf of Ahmed Ibrahim to branch master.
- Commit Hook
On April 23, 2014, 7:46 p.m., Ahmed Ibrahim w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://git.reviewboard.kde.org/r/117729/
> -----------------------------------------------------------
>
> (Updated April 23, 2014, 7:46 p.m.)
>
>
> Review request for Telepathy.
>
>
> Bugs: 333742
> http://bugs.kde.org/show_bug.cgi?id=333742
>
>
> Repository: ktp-text-ui
>
>
> Description
> -------
>
> This bug happens when the user has switched the keyboard layout of a chat tab and then switched to another application with another language, And he received a message or an "is typing" chat status, the language is then changed to the language of the Chat Tab that he was previously in, which is of course is an annoying behavior.
>
> The reason of this behavior is that the restoreKeyboardLayout method is called inside the onCurrentIndexChanged without making sure that the Chat Window is active.
>
>
> Diffs
> -----
>
> app/chat-window.cpp a7da574
>
> Diff: https://git.reviewboard.kde.org/r/117729/diff/
>
>
> Testing
> -------
>
> Changed language of the Chat Tab and then went to chromium and sent a message to myself from another account, that language did not change.
> Also tried composing a message to myself from another account and the language did not change.
>
>
> Thanks,
>
> Ahmed Ibrahim
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kde-telepathy/attachments/20140423/296c3744/attachment.html>
More information about the KDE-Telepathy
mailing list